This only holds somewhat true for mods which modify the same files as other mods, i.e. campaigns with differing versions of Oldskool. If a mod only DEPENDS on another, that doesn't cause any issues. It would only crumble "like a house of cards" if the user is seriously terrible at installing them.

IIRC EXU 1 just uses Excessive UT weapons, and that's about it in terms of big dependencies. It's just a clean dependency, though, nothing existing is being modified, just used/built upon.
